Sat 791311268560532

decimal
158262.1268560532
degree
0°158262′1014″1268560532‴
percentile
37.681489020522605%
name
ifzvehfqbrx
cycle
0
epoch
0
period
78
block
158262
offset
1268560532
timestamp
rarity
common